Gaddafi is a rare family name in Libya. The most famous is Colonel Mu'ammar al-Gaddafi who seized power in Libya in a military coup on 1st September 1969 and formed a Revolutionary Command Council to rule the country. On March 2nd 1977 Libya changed its name to the Socialist People's Libyan Arab Jamahiriya and declared a "State of the Masses" with a novel form of direct participatory democracy that is outlined in The Green Book, attributed to the authorship of Mu'ammar Gaddafi. On April 15th 1986 Libya was attacked by the British and USA via aerial bombing, that killed hundreds of Libyans in Tripoli and Benghazi, included the adopted baby daughter of Mu'ammar Gaddafi.
